Norman Fortress - 12th Century Castle between the Adriatic Sea, Gran Sasso, and Maiella FOR INFORMATION CALL [hidden information] In the heart of the most authentic Abruzzo, among the hills descending towards the Adriatic Sea and the majestic peaks of Gran Sasso d’Italia and Maiella, the Castle has dominated the landscape for over nine centuries, preserving the charm of one of the rarest and most evocative historic residences in central Italy. An authentic Norman fortress, the complex is an extraordinary example of medieval fortified architecture. The majestic keep, stone walls, watchtowers, and ancient defensive paths tell a millennial story intertwined with the territory’s history, offering today an invaluable heritage of historical, architectural, and scenic significance. Set within a private estate of about six hectares, the castle enjoys an absolutely privileged location. From the towers and the most panoramic points of the property, the view simultaneously opens onto the Adriatic Sea, the Corno Grande of Gran Sasso, and the profile of Maiella, offering a rare and breathtaking perspective that changes with the seasons and light. Over the years, the property has undergone careful restoration and enhancement that has fully preserved its historical identity while integrating modern technologies and services. A particularly important feature is the seismic upgrading of the structure, a significant intervention that ensures solidity and safety for such an important architectural heritage. Another distinctive element is the absence of restrictions from the Superintendence, a particularly rare circumstance for a historic property of this level, offering greater management and design flexibility while fully respecting the cultural and identity value of the complex. Currently used as a charming hospitality venue, the castle offers six rooms with private bathrooms, including elegant suites with panoramic terraces, several independent apartments, and a prestigious representative apartment of about 300 sqm, skillfully restored respecting the original characteristics of the residence. The property also includes spaces dedicated to hospitality and events, featuring a hall of about 400 sqm that can accommodate up to 180 people, ideal for private receptions, weddings, institutional events, and high-profile hospitality projects. The presence of a natural spring within the complex also opens interesting prospects for creating a spa or an exclusive wellness area. The estate includes gardens, historic courtyards, large green areas, and lands that completely surround the castle, ensuring privacy, seclusion, and an environment of absolute prestige. Completing the property, modern plant systems ensure high standards of comfort and energy efficiency, including: - Photovoltaic system with storage - High-efficiency hybrid system - Heat pump - Air conditioning - Fiber optic connection - Double vehicular access More than just a real estate property, the Castle represents a unique heritage asset: a place where history, landscape, prestige, and entrepreneurial potential coexist in perfect balance, creating one of the most fascinating opportunities currently available in the Italian historic residences market.
